1. Liposuction
With the increase of people being conscious about their body shape, this procedure has become quite common, especially in women. Liposuction is a minimally-invasive procedure using a powerful suction pump, ultrasound, or laser. Those fat-removing tools all involve sucking all the fat through a tube.
This surgery targets the removal of excess fat beneath the skin from the stomach, thighs, buttocks, arms, chin, and back. At the maximum, the whole recovery process may take as long as three months, but you can resume work in 5-7 days once the procedure is done. However, you will still need to exercise to keep in shape.

2. Tummy Tuck or Abdominoplasty
Abdominoplasty helps tuck in sagging skin after weight loss or childbirth. As the name suggests, it’s meant to enhance the shape of the abdomen by tightening up the abdominal muscles and give you a slimmer and flatter waistline. It’s ideal for people struggling with stubborn fat, especially around the stomach and waistline area. The maximum full recovery time for this is around eight weeks.
3. Hair Transplantation
This procedure is for you if you have balding, thinning hair, or general hair growth concerns. A hair transplant is done by transferring small hairpieces from an area with thick hair growth to a bald or thinned area on your scalp.
Some may take more than one session to complete it fully. You’re likely to see hair growth 6-9 months after the procedure is done for most. However, if your hair loss is genetic-based, even a hair transplant might not resolve it. So, have all the facts at hand before going for it.
4. Rhinoplasty
Some of the breathing problems you have endured for a long time may have been caused by poor alignment of the airways in your nose. This issue is very common and can be corrected by rhinoplasty. Rhinoplasty has for a long time helped realign the structure of the nasal passages restoring normal breathing. Others have also used it to have their face reshaped for a facial balance—the whole recovery period for people who undergo this takes about four weeks.
5. Breast Enhancements

These enhancements may vary from person to person, but all of them are meant to enhance appearance. Some may want a lift, others a reduction, while others may wish for an enlargement. Let’s discuss them briefly below:
- Breast Augmentation- commonly known as breast enlargement, is done by inserting silicone or saline implants to enlarge the breasts for people with smaller breasts. Others may also undergo this procedure to make their breast size proportional, especially after pregnancy or breastfeeding. For them to look natural, it might take six months.
- Breast Reduction- This procedure resizes breasts to a smaller size by removing a substantial amount of fat, skin, and skin from the breast and repositioning them. A full recovery for this takes approximately six weeks.
- Breast lift- Almost similar to a breast reduction, but it only removes a sizable amount of skin and tightens tissue giving one a pleasant breast lift. A full recovery for this takes 12 weeks to achieve the final shape you need.
6. Dermabrasion
Do you want to look young and have smooth skin? This procedure will work for you if you’re concerned about wrinkles, acne spots, sunburns, or scars. Dermabrasion is a short-time non-invasive surgery that will improve your facial outlook. It involves moving a small machine across your face while enhancing pressure to remove the old top skin layer replacing it with new skin. For visible results, it might take three months.
7. Lip Filling
Lip filling is another increasingly popular cosmetic procedure that aims to make the lips look fuller. The surgeon uses injectable dermal fillers in a gradual and spaced motion to increase the lips’ volume while still making sure that they eventually look natural. It takes the minimal time possible to get done. It might take four weeks to achieve the desired look.
